Assembly

The Heathkit RP-1065 is provided as a kit requiring assembly. Follow these steps carefully:

  1. Unpack Components: Carefully unpack all components and verify against the parts list provided in the kit. Report any missing or damaged parts immediately.
  2. Prepare Circuit Board: Solder all resistors, capacitors, diodes, and integrated circuits to the printed circuit board (PCB) according to the provided schematic and component placement guide. Pay close attention to component polarity.
  3. Wire Controls: Connect the potentiometer for speed control, the DPDT switch for direction, and any other control switches to the PCB using the specified wire gauges and soldering techniques.
  4. Enclosure Assembly: Mount the assembled PCB, controls, and input/output terminals into the provided enclosure. Ensure all components are securely fastened and properly aligned.
  5. Power Connections: Connect the power input jack and output terminals for track power. Double-check all wiring for continuity and correct connections before applying power.
  6. Final Inspection: Perform a visual inspection of all solder joints and wiring. Ensure no stray wires or solder bridges are present that could cause a short circuit.

Setup

Once assembled, follow these steps to set up your electronic throttle:

  1. Power Connection: Connect the appropriate DC power supply (e.g., 12-16V DC, 1A minimum) to the throttle's power input jack. Ensure the power supply is unplugged from the wall outlet during connection.
  2. Track Connection: Connect the throttle's track output terminals to your model railroad track. Ensure correct polarity if your layout uses block wiring or specific track sections.
  3. Initial Power-Up: Plug in the power supply. The throttle should power on without any unusual noises or smells. If any issues arise, immediately disconnect power and re-check assembly.
  4. Test with Locomotive: Place a locomotive on the track. Set the direction switch to a desired direction and slowly advance the speed control potentiometer. The locomotive should move smoothly.

Operating Instructions

The Heathkit RP-1065 offers intuitive control over your model railroad locomotives:

  • Speed Control: Rotate the large knob (potentiometer) clockwise to increase locomotive speed and counter-clockwise to decrease speed. The throttle provides smooth, continuous speed adjustment.
  • Direction Control: Use the toggle switch to select the direction of travel (Forward/Reverse). Change direction only when the locomotive is stopped or moving at a very low speed to prevent damage.
  • Momentary Brake/Stop (if applicable): Some models may include a momentary switch for quick stops or braking. Press and hold to apply, release to resume previous speed.

For optimal performance, avoid sudden changes in speed or direction, especially with older or sensitive locomotives.

Troubleshooting

Problem Possible Cause Solution
Throttle not powering on. No power from outlet; faulty power supply; incorrect wiring during assembly. Check wall outlet; test power supply; verify internal wiring connections.
Locomotive not moving. No power to track; dirty track/wheels; direction switch in neutral; speed control at minimum; short circuit on track. Ensure track connections are secure; clean track and locomotive wheels; check direction switch; increase speed; inspect track for shorts.
Erratic locomotive movement. Poor track conductivity; loose wiring connections; faulty potentiometer. Clean track; check all wiring connections; if potentiometer is suspected, consult Heathkit support.
Throttle gets excessively hot. Overload on track; internal short circuit; improper power supply. Reduce load on track; immediately disconnect power and inspect internal wiring for shorts; ensure correct power supply voltage and current rating.
